About UNI



The University of Northern Iowa (UNI) is a public university in Cedar Falls, Iowa. For more than 120 years, the University of Northern Iowa has fostered a premier learning and teaching environment. While emphasizing undergraduate education, UNI offers graduate programs at the master’s, specialist’s and doctoral levels.

UNI offers nearly 160 majors, minors and areas of study across the colleges of Business Administration, Education, Health and Human Sciences, Humanities and Fine Arts, Natural Sciences, Social and Behavioral Sciences and Graduate College.  

In the Fall 2024, UNI will begin offering an undergraduate Bachelor of Science in Nursing.  Also in 2024, UNI will be adding a Bachelor of Science in Materials Science & Engineering as well as a Bachelor of Science in Materials Science Engineering Technology.  An education from UNI can set you up for future success—no matter what your ultimate goals are.  

The University of Northern Iowa is ranked second in the "Best Regional Universities (Midwest)" category for public universities, according to U.S. News & World Report's 2020 "America's Best Colleges" guidebook. UNI was also 20th on a combined list of all public and private Midwest regional universities.  UNI was also named the best public college in Iowa for getting a job with a 94% job placement rate.
